 Marcus Morris Sr. arrested on felony fraud charge
Rob Gray-Imagn Images

Marcus Morris Sr. has been arrested on a felony fraud charge. This is according to online jail records.

Morris Sr. hasn’t played in the NBA since the 2023-24 season where he only appeared in 49 games. He last played for the Cleveland Cavaliers before being waived in September 2024, after signing with the New York Knicks.

The exact reason for the charge is being reported as casino debt. According to Morris Sr.’s agent, Yony Noy, it isn’t a fraud charge at all, just unpaid debt to the casino that is valued over $1,200.

As of this morning, Morris Sr. was being held at the Broward County Main Jail as he awaits extradition.
